Now, let’s turn our attention to geography. How many countries can you name that start with ‘I’? India, of course, is the most prominent. A land of ancient history, vibrant culture, and incredible diversity. From the Himalayas to the beaches of Goa, India offers a sensory feast for the traveler. Then there’s Indonesia, a vast archipelago of thousands of islands, each with its own unique character and traditions. A land of volcanoes, rainforests, and stunning beaches, Indonesia is a paradise for nature lovers.
And don’t forget Ireland, the Emerald Isle. A land of rolling green hills, ancient castles, and lively pubs. Ireland is known for its friendly people, its rich history, and its vibrant musical traditions.
